Find the odds:
A bag contains 6 red marbles, 8 blue marbles, and 9 green marbles. What are the odds of choosing a red marble?

Answer:

6/23

Step-by-step explanation:

First, find the total number of marbles:

6 + 8 + 9

= 23

There are 6 red marbles out of the 23.

So, the odds of choosing one will be 6/23.
